Understanding Chrome Proxies

At its core, the term “proxy” embodies the idea of substitution or acting in place of something else. In the context of web browsing, a proxy takes on the role of your browser and device. It presents its own IP address, concealing your actual IP address and its associated location. The advantages of this will become apparent as we progress.

The use of a proxy can also lead to enhanced connection speeds, contingent upon the type and location of the proxy. Certain web pages may load more swiftly when accessed through a proxy. Additionally, proxies can offer heightened security, though this is contingent on the quality of the proxies you employ.

A Chrome proxy, in essence, shares common ground with a standard proxy server. It serves as an intermediary server situated between your device and the server hosting the website you are visiting. Its primary function is to shield your device’s Internet Protocol (IP) address from external view.

Chrome stands out as one of the most popular web browsers for several reasons. Its reputation is built on its speed, compatibility across various operating systems, and an extensive library of native and third-party add-ons, or extensions, that enhance its functionality. Consequently, it boasts an impressive user base, with over 2.65 billion users as of January 2020.

A proxy, when employed within Chrome, essentially functions as an extension that acts as an intermediary between Chrome and the server housing the target website. In this regard, it closely mirrors the role of any other proxy used in the realm of business operations.

When you enter a URL into the search bar or click a link on the search results page, a request is initiated from your device, traversing the internet until it reaches the server hosting the target website. In response, the server transmits the website to your browser, where it is rendered for your viewing.

It’s important to note that this request carries with it the IP address specific to your device, which is a unique identifier for each device. This IP address also reveals geolocation information, pinpointing the exact origin of the request.

By employing an anonymous proxy, Chrome redirects the request through the proxy server. Consequently, the server hosting the website does not perceive the IP address of the device running Chrome. Instead, it detects the IP address of the proxy server. In essence, proxy servers designed for Chrome serve as intermediaries, positioned between Chrome and the vast expanse of the internet.

Understanding the Types of Proxies

Now that we’ve illuminated the compelling aspect of location manipulation, it’s crucial to explore the various types of proxies available for use with the Chrome browser. The choice of proxy type plays a pivotal role in determining the performance of the proxy and the specific purpose for which you’re utilizing it. Let’s take a closer look at the main categories of proxies:

1. Residential Proxies: These proxies, also known as residential IPs, are typically assigned to physical residences by local internet service providers (ISPs). They are real IP addresses with a specific geographic location. Using a residential proxy allows you to virtually be present in another location, affording you the privileges associated with that area.

2. Data Center Proxies: Unlike residential proxies, data center proxies are situated within data centers equipped with numerous servers. These proxies are not tied to any particular ISP and may lack a specific physical address depending on the data center’s location. Data center IPs are a popular choice for those seeking bulk proxies for web scraping.

3. Semi-Dedicated Proxies: Semi-dedicated proxies, often referred to as shared proxies, are IP addresses shared by multiple parties. When you acquire these proxies, you gain access for a specific duration based on your payment. This shared nature renders them more economical, but it also means you may not have exclusive control over the proxy, and it might not be available round the clock.

4. Dedicated Proxies: As the name implies, dedicated proxies are exclusively reserved for the buyer’s use. This includes not only the proxy but also the associated resources. These proxies are the most expensive option due to their exclusivity.

5. Rotating Proxies: While rotating proxies are not a distinct type, they can be applied to residential, data center, or dedicated proxies. These proxies operate on an auto-rotating mechanism for routing requests. For example, if you have a set of ten different proxies, they will cycle through a round-robin system after a specific time or a predetermined number of requests. The last proxy in the stack moves to the back, and a new one takes its place at the front of the queue. The advantages of this approach will become apparent shortly.

Configuring a Proxy for Chrome: A Step-By-Step Guide

Chrome Proxies – Your Guide to Enhanced Web Security

Setting up a proxy in Chrome may vary slightly based on your operating system. Below, we’ll walk you through the process for both Windows and Mac. Before you begin, make sure you have the necessary IP address and port number at your disposal.

On Windows:

1. Open the Chrome application on your Windows device and click on the “Customize and control Chrome” button located at the top right corner, represented by three vertical dots.

2. Select “Settings,” and a new settings tab will open.

3. In the left-hand side menu, click on “Advanced,” and then choose “System.”

4. Click on “Open your computer’s proxy settings,” which will launch the Network & Internet dialog box in Windows.

5. In this dialog box, uncheck the option that says “Automatically detect settings.”

6. Under “Manual Proxy Server,” activate the toggle for “Use a proxy server.”

7. Enter the IP address in the “Address” text box and the port number in the “Port” text box.

8. Click “Save.”

Congratulations, you’ve successfully configured the proxy server for use with Chrome. On the Network & Internet Settings page, you’ll also find a box that allows you to specify addresses for which you don’t want to use the proxy server. This comes in handy if you wish to send requests directly to specific servers without routing them through the proxy.

On Mac:

Setting up an anonymous proxy for Chrome on a Mac is quite similar to the Windows process, with only a few initial differences.

1. Launch the Chrome application on your Mac device and click on “Preferences” from the top menu.

2. In the left-hand side menu, click on “Advanced,” and then select “System.”

3. Click on “Open your computer’s proxy settings.”

4. On the proxy tab, click on the box next to the proxy you wish to set up, labeled “Select a proxy to configure.”

5. Now, enter the IP address and port number in the respective text boxes.

6. You’ll be prompted to enter the credentials provided by your proxy provider.

7. Input the credentials, click “Okay,” and then “Apply.”

With these steps completed, you’re ready to browse the internet and conduct your online activities through the proxy server. To verify that the proxy is functioning correctly, you can check your IP address. Simply visit a website like whatismyipaddress.com and see if the IP address has changed successfully. If your actual IP address is displayed, it indicates that the proxy server may not have been configured correctly or is not functioning as intended.

Proxies vs. VPN For Chrome: Making the Right Choice

When you embark on your journey to enhance online privacy, security, or access to restricted content, you might find yourself at a crossroads, faced with the decision of choosing between proxies and VPNs (virtual private networks). While both offer solutions for Chrome users, it’s essential to understand the differences between these two technologies and which one aligns best with your objectives.

Proxies:

A proxy, in essence, serves as an intermediary that reroutes your internet requests through a specific server, which you configure manually. This server then connects to the desired web resource on your behalf. By doing so, your actual IP address remains concealed, and the web server sees the IP address of the proxy server instead.

VPNs:

On the other hand, VPNs also utilize proxies but in a more comprehensive manner. When you opt for a VPN, you’re essentially changing your IP address, much like a proxy. However, a VPN creates a private and anonymous connection with web servers by rerouting your requests through multiple servers in a network. This network connection is often encrypted, adding an extra layer of security.

Key Differences:

1. Request Handling: Proxies reroute your requests through specific servers you configure, whereas VPNs establish a network connection that routes your traffic through multiple servers.

2. Encryption: VPNs typically encrypt all your web requests and traffic, providing a higher level of privacy and security. Proxies, on the other hand, may only mask the IP addresses for specific types of requests, such as HTTP or SOCKS.

3. IP Address Control: With VPNs, you might not have much control over your IP address, as most apps and extensions automatically assign one. This limitation becomes more apparent with free VPNs, where you might not have the option to choose your preferred IP location.

4. Streaming Restrictions: Free VPNs can be easily detected by streaming websites, making them less effective for accessing geo-restricted content.

Choosing the Right Option:

The decision between using a proxy or a VPN depends on your specific needs. While VPNs offer comprehensive security and privacy features, they may not provide as much autonomy in choosing IP addresses as proxies do. Free VPNs, in particular, often limit your choices and can be blocked by streaming services.

For applications like web scraping, proxies tend to be a more viable option. They allow for more control over IP addresses and can help avoid both temporary and permanent blocks.
